Czech artist Tom Havlasek has created these stunning paintings of retro racing cars, depicting everything from Ayrton Senna's classic red and white McLaren to Nicki Lauder's legendary Ferrari.
Havlasek's portraits in acrylic paint capture the speed and energy of racing's halcyon days.
